Dynamic Web Layouts: Ensuring Seamless Mobile Experiences
In today's mobile-first world, providing a stellar user experience across all devices is vital. Responsive web design has emerged as the leading solution for achieving this goal. This technique utilizes flexible layouts and media queries to automatically adjust website content and design based on the screen size click here and orientation of the device. By implementing responsive design, you can ensure your website is viewable across a broad range of devices, from mobile phones to tablets and desktops.

Harnessing the Strength of Visual Hierarchy
A well-structured online presence relies heavily on visual hierarchy. This means strategically arranging elements to guide the user's eye and emphasize crucial content. By utilizing size, color, placement, and whitespace effectively, designers can create a clear pathway for visitors, making information easily digestible and enhancing the overall user experience.
- Prioritizing key messages through font sizes helps users quickly grasp the most important points.
- Implementing whitespace prevents a cluttered appearance and allows content to breathe.
- Color can be used to accentuate specific elements, further guiding user sight.
Ultimately, a strong visual hierarchy makes that your website is not only aesthetically pleasing but also functional and user-friendly. By following these principles, you can create a site that effectively communicates your message and keeps visitors engaged.
